Supple and full of moisture. A moisturizing cream has been created that enhances moisturizing power and maintains moisture by incorporating Trio Lipid*1. Contains CICA extract*2 and Vitamin E derivative*3. Gently moisturizes even dry and sensitive skin. A smooth, comfortable texture that firmly seals in moisture. For supple, moisturized skin that can withstand external stimuli such as dryness and dryness. *1 Wheat bran extract containing cholesterol, linoleic acid, and ceramide: moisturizing ingredient *2 Centella asiatica extract: moisturizing ingredient *3 Tocopherol acetate: antioxidant in the product

I love it so much that I can't even count how many times I've bought it. My skin is thin and easily gets rough and red, but when I use this cream, it calms down in a few days. The 100H cream doesn't have enough moisturizing power for my dry skin. Even when I try other creams, I always come back to this one. I will continue to use it.
For some reason, I received a free copy of the product from Clinique. It's non-irritating and moisturizes quite well. It didn't work very well on the dry fine lines on my forehead. Personally, I prefer Curel's cream.
I've been buying this product for a long time. The cream spreads easily and can be used daily without irritation, even on sensitive skin. Applying this helps prevent dry skin.
I also have a gel type, which I use depending on my mood and skin condition. This one contains oil, so it's a good talisman for those times when I feel like the gel isn't moisturizing enough (due to hormonal cycles rather than seasonality).
I used to use CLINIQUE's Moisture Gel, but I switched to this one. Both products keep my skin moisturized, so I like them both, but I personally find the cream type to be slower to wear out and last longer. It comes in a 50ml bottle, and it's in this price range, so I'd like to buy it again (*´-`)
